Oh boy. Well I guess i'l be committed to this project now. I had heard about the 4.0 and it's reputation for overheating so when I bought the truck last week I closely inspected the oil and antifreeze for any signs of mixing. I didn't see any of that in either, nothing visually, not by feel, not by smell.
But I got it to my garage today and actually gave it a headgasket test (I was suspicious about my fluctuating temperature gauge) and she failed almost immediately.
So it's scheduled for next week at my friend's shop. A cool $800-$1,000 if the heads aren't toasted.
Well now that this is my reality, what can I do once it's fixed to make sure it doesn't happen again? Was it a factory problem that will be resolved once the repair is completed or should I look at a better cooling radiator or something?
